Self-vacuums make use of a mix of sensing units, video cameras, expert system (AI), and excellent software algorithms to carry out cleaning tasks. Here's a breakdown of the elements:
Sensors and Cameras: Help the vacuum map out the area while discovering challenges and figuring out the most effective cleaning course.Navigation Intelligence: Advanced algorithms produce a map of the home and track the vacuum's cleaning progress, guaranteeing that no areas are missed out on.Brush and Suction Mechanism: Designed to enhance debris pickup from various surfaces, consisting of carpet and wood floorings.Self-Charging: Most designs return to their docking stations to recharge as soon as their battery is low.The Benefits of Self-Vacuums

While self-vacuums are created for benefit, they do need regular upkeep to sustain their effectiveness:
Regular Emptying: Most robotic vacuums have a bin that needs to be emptied regularly.Cleaning Brushes: Hair and debris can cover around the brushes, decreasing suction power and performance.Filter Replacement: HEPA filters and other components ought to be replaced per the producer's guidelines.Preserving the Sensors: Keep sensing units clean to guarantee efficient navigation and efficiency.Typical Questions (FAQ)
